FED project OS031 complete

Logistics In Action: Article originally appeared on the US Army Corps of Engineers Far East District website — The U.S. Army Corps of Engineers Far East District commemorated the completion of project CY13 ROKFC IN-KIND Bulk Fuel Storage Tanks and Pumps (OS031), with an Acceptance Release Letter (ARL) ceremony in Pyeongtaek, Republic of Korea, Dec. 7.

FED nears completion of Fuel Project OS031

Logistics In Action: Article originally appeared on the US Army Corps of Engineers Far East District website — The U.S. Army Corps of Engineers (USACE) Far East District (FED) continues construction on OS031 Fuel Oil Facility, the second phase of a three-part construction project, located on USAG Humphreys.

Battlefield Sustainment on the Korean Peninsula

Logistics In Action: Article originally appeared on the U.S. Indo-Pacific Command website — Since 1953, the Korean Peninsula has been under a United Nations Command (UNC)-led armistice between the Republic of Korea (ROK) and the Democratic People's Republic of Korea (North Korea). In order to maintain this armistice, Eighth Army has remained forward-deployed on the peninsula.
